When is an Upper Gastrointestinal Endoscopy Needed?

When you start noticing symptoms such as upper abdominal pain, nausea, vomiting, or issues swallowing, you should contact your gastroenterologist in Chicago and Oakbrook Terrace, IL, to find out if an upper gastrointestinal endoscopy (EGD) is needed. This test can accurately detect issues like inflammation, ulcers, or tumors.

If an EGD is needed, your gastroenterologist will discuss your symptoms and explain what they may be looking for. During the test, your doctor may take a biopsy to check for multiple issues and bring back for testing. An endoscopy can help find issues and is non-surgical and requires very little downtime. This helps make the test easier on you and won’t add to any of the issues that you’re experiencing.

An EGD will also be performed if your doctor suspects that you may be dealing with any bleeding in your gastrointestinal tract. An EGD can help treat the bleeding immediately and will allow your doctor to check for the cause of bleeding. They’ll be able to perform an analysis and help you start treating your issues as soon as possible.
